5. Emergency - Hindi (Expanding Release)
Release Date: Wide release January 17, 2026 Director: Kangana Ranaut Cast: Kangana Ranaut, Anupam Kher, Shreyas Talpade, Mahima Chaudhary
Synopsis: After a limited release earlier, Emergency gets a wide theatrical expansion. The political drama chronicles the events of the 1975 Emergency in India, with Kangana Ranaut portraying former Prime Minister Indira Gandhi. The film covers the controversial 21-month period that remains one of the most debated chapters in Indian democracy.
